Redirected from That Acapulco Gold. The Rainy Daze was a psychedelic pop group formed in Denver, Colorado in 1965. They were composed of singerguitarist Tim Gilbert with his brother Kip on drums, lead guitarist Mac Ferris, bassist Sam Fuller, and keyboardist Bob Heckendorf. The group started as a covers act, nevertheless parlaying a string of frat party gigs into a local television appearance that reportedly caught the attention of famed producer Phil Spector, who extended a management contract. Psychedelic pop group The Rainy Daze released a 1967 album titled That Acapulco Gold, portraying Mexico as a far-off land where the streets are lined with bricks of that Acapulco Gold. The title track reached 70 on the Billboard Hot 100 before being pulled from circulation for promoting marijuana use.
